Transaction 35f0dc15d160b12bda064ec47bc29b15d454dcb69201247188950de1b057e029

2 Input
1 Outputs
  • 35f0dc15d160b12bda064ec47bc29b15d454dcb69201247188950de1b057e029:0
  • value  104500
    address  1M8Kv5aQ72HKCXRsYKkdKaXUQNSjkpbdiD